Tenna Winther Wreck
| Field | Value |
|---|---|
| Wreck Category | non-dangerous wreck |
|
Tenna winther Wreck Location Marine Coordinates (DMM) |
58 31.96 N,1 25.9 E |
| Latitude, Longitude Decimal Degrees |
|
| Wreck Depth | 105 m |
| Water Depth | 125 m |
| Water Level Effect | always under water/submerged |
| Vertical Datum | Approximate Lowest Astronomical Tide |
| Name | TENNA WINTHER |
| Type | trawler |
| Flag | DK |
| Length | 33.5 m |
| Width | 6.7 m |
| Draught | 3 |
| Tonnage | 149 |
| Tonnage Type | gross |
| Conspic Visual | not visually conspicuous |
| Conspic Radar | not radar conspicuous |
| Date Sunk | Nov 2, 1984 |
| Original Detection Year | 1984 |
| Original Source | national coast guard or patrol |
| Surveying Details | H4147/82 23.11.84 H4147/82 23.11.84 LAST SEEN IN 583200N, 012600E. WAS NOT LOCATED DURING FURTHER SEARCH 2 HOURS LATER. (MRCC ABERDEEN). INS AS WK USC PA 105MTRS. (TONNAGE KNOWN). BR STD. |
| Last Amended Date | Jan 2, 1985 |
Circumstances of loss
20.11.84 WAS DAMAGED, ALLEGED TO BE INFRINGING SAFETY ZONE, WHILE IN COLLISION IN THICK FOG WITH BRITISH D-E SUPPLY VESSEL ATLANTIC DENHOLM. ABANDONED BY CREW. WAS LAST SEEN WITH ENGINE STOPPED, LOW IN THE WATER AND SINKING SOME 4 HOURS LATER. PRESUMED TO HAVE SUNK. CREW RECOVERED. (LL, 20.11.84).
